GOLDEN SHORES–A local man is in jail facing several felony drug charges after a search warrant was served Friday morning at a residence in Golden Shores.
Mohave County Sheriff’s Office spokeswoman Anita Mortensen said deputies and MAGNET detectives executed the search warrant shortly after 5 a.m. Friday at a home in the 4600 block of Shore Drive.
One male–later identified as David Leon Potter, 51–and two females were removed from the home and detained while deputies searched the residence, Mortensen said. The search reportedly uncovered 3.5 grams of methamphetamine, marijuana wax, unknown pills, multiple glass pipes, a scale, over $1000 in cash, and a surveillance systems with about six different views of the residence.
Potter was taken to the Mohave County jail for possession of dangerous drugs, possession of dangerous drugs for sale, and possession of drug paraphernalia, all felonies. Debra Mariedth Drean, 63, of Topock was arrested on suspicion of the same charges, but due to health reasons, Drean was cited and released at the scene. She will be required to appear at a later date, Mortensen said. The other female was released from the scene.
